19. guration and DMA registers Quartus II Software Development Kit Edition DKE The Quartus II software provides a comprehensive environment for system on a programmable chip SOPC design The Quartus II software integrates into nearly any design environment with interfaces to industry standard EDA tools The kit includes The SOPC Builder system development tool e A one year Quartus II software license Windows platform only Getting Started User Guide 1 1 PCI Express Development Kit Stratix Il GX Edition Documentation Quartus DKE software license allows you to use the product for 12 months After 12 months you must purchase a renewal subscription to continue using the software For more information refer to the Altera website at www altera com MegaCore IP Library CD ROM version 6 0 This CD ROM contains Altera IP MegaCore functions You can evaluate the MegaCore functions using the OpenCore Plus feature which allows you to do the following e Simulate the behavior of a MegaCore function within your system e Verify the functionality of your design as well as quickly and easily evaluate its size and speed e Generate time limited device programming files for designs that include MegaCore functions e Programa device and verify your design in hardware You only need to purchase a license for a MegaCore function when you are completely satisfied with its functionality and performance and want

25. rdware and software development tools as well as the documentation and accessories you need to begin developing PCIe systems using the Stratix GX device This user guide will familiarize you with the contents of the kit and walk you through setting a PCIe development environment In this guide you will do the following Inspect the contents of the kit Install the development tools software Set up licensing Use the kit s demo application and example design to e Configure the on board Stratix GX device e Perform memory read and write transactions on the board e Read configuration and DMA registers Before using the kit or installing the software be sure to check the kit s contents and inspect the board to verify that you received all of the items listed in this section If any of the items are missing contact Altera before you proceed You should also verify that your computer s hardware and software meet the kit s system requirements Getting Started User Guide 2 1 PCI Express Development Kit Stratix Il GX Edtion Before You Begin Check the Kit s Contents The PCI Express Development Kit Stratix GX Edition ordering code DK PCIE 2SGX90N contains the following items Stratix GX PCI Express development board with EP2SGX90FF40C3NES Stratix GX device PCI Express Development Kit Stratix II GX Edition CD ROM version 1 0 0 which includes PCI Express example design e PCI Expre
26. ss development kit application and device drivers One year license of Quartus II Software Development Kit Edition DKE Windows only platform MegaCore IP Library CD ROM USB Blaster download cable Power supply and adapters for North America Europe the United Kingdom and Japan Heatsink fan combination and board standoff hardware Complete documentation e PCI Express Development Kit Stratix II GX Edition Getting Started User Guide this document Stratix GX PCI Express Development Board Reference Manual Schematic and board design files Inspect the Board Place the board on an anti static surface and inspect it to ensure that it has not been damaged during shipment Verify that all components are on the board and appear intact I gt Intypical applications with the PCI Express development board 2 2 a heatsink is not necessary However under extreme conditions the board may require the use of additional cooling to stay within operating temperature guidelines Power consumption and thermal modeling should be done to determine whether additional cooling is necessary In the event that it is a heatsink fan combination has been provided for your convenience Without proper anti static handling the Stratix GX PCI Express development board can be damaged Getting Started User Guide Altera Corporation PCI Express Development Kit Stratix Il GX Edtion August 2006 Getting Started Figure 2 1 shows t
